/**
* This {@link CacheLoader} is used to encapsulate the {@link CacheLoader} used to persist the data of the Locks.
* This is used to prevent {@link TimeoutException} that occur when several threads try to access the same data
* at the same time and the data is missing in the local cache which is the case most of the time, since no data
* means that the node is not locked. Since all the lock data will be loaded at startup, this {@link CacheLoader}
* will only call the nested {@link CacheLoader} for read operations when the cache status is CacheStatus.STARTING,
* for all other status, we don't call the nested cache loader since if no data cans be found in the local cache,
* it means that there is no data to load because all the lock data has been loaded at startup.

/**
* @see org.jboss.cache.loader.CacheLoader#exists(org.jboss.cache.Fqn)
*/
public boolean exists(Fqn name) throws Exception
{
if (cache.getCacheStatus() == CacheStatus.STARTING)
{
// Before calling the nested cache loader we first check if the data exists in the local cache
// in order to prevent multiple call to the cache store
NodeSPI<?, ?> node = cache.peek(name, false);
if (node != null)
{
// The node already exists in the local cache, so we return true
return true;
}
else
{
// The node doesn't exist in the local cache, so we need to check through the nested
// cache loader
return cl.exists(name);
}
}
// All the data is loaded at startup, so no need to call the nested cache loader for another
// cache status other than CacheStatus.STARTING
return false;
}
/**
* @see org.jboss.cache.loader.CacheLoader#get(org.jboss.cache.Fqn)
*/
public Map<Object, Object> get(Fqn name) throws Exception
{
if (cache.getCacheStatus() == CacheStatus.STARTING)
{
// Before calling the nested cache loader we first check if the data exists in the local cache
// in order to prevent multiple call to the cache store
NodeSPI node = cache.peek(name, false);
if (node != null)
{
// The node already exists in the local cache, so we return the corresponding data
return node.getDataDirect();
}
else
{
// The node doesn't exist in the local cache, so we need to check through the nested
// cache loader
return cl.get(name);
}
}
// All the data is loaded at startup, so no need to call the nested cache loader for another
// cache status other than CacheStatus.STARTING
return null;
}
